Solution

The correct option is B

Cones


Cone cells, or cones, are of three types. They are photoreceptor cells in the retina of mammalian eyes (e.g. the human eye). They are responsible for colour vision and function best in relatively bright light, as opposed to rod cells, which work better in dim light.
